Description of Adams Mark Hotel Buffalo
From its spirited fountain to the glass-and-brass glamour of its porte cochere to the spacious, elegant lobby, the Adam's Mark Buffalo-Niagara greets you with a remarkable sense of style. The vibrant energy of the lobby restaurants and lounges, along with the elegance of the rich woodwork, mirrored columns and chandeliers, impart a feeling of importance to your stay. read more
